diff options
author | V3n3RiX <venerix@redcorelinux.org> | 2018-07-14 21:03:06 +0100 |
---|---|---|
committer | V3n3RiX <venerix@redcorelinux.org> | 2018-07-14 21:03:06 +0100 |
commit | 8376ef56580626e9c0f796d5b85b53a0a1c7d5f5 (patch) | |
tree | 7681bbd4e8b05407772df40a4bf04cbbc8afc3fa /app-office/kraft | |
parent | 30a9caf154332f12ca60756e1b75d2f0e3e1822d (diff) |
gentoo resync : 14.07.2018
Diffstat (limited to 'app-office/kraft')
-rw-r--r-- | app-office/kraft/Manifest | 4 | ||||
-rw-r--r-- | app-office/kraft/files/kraft-0.80-qt-5.11.patch | 63 | ||||
-rw-r--r-- | app-office/kraft/kraft-0.80.ebuild | 51 | ||||
-rw-r--r-- | app-office/kraft/metadata.xml | 14 |
4 files changed, 132 insertions, 0 deletions
diff --git a/app-office/kraft/Manifest b/app-office/kraft/Manifest new file mode 100644 index 000000000000..541522e2b56f --- /dev/null +++ b/app-office/kraft/Manifest @@ -0,0 +1,4 @@ +AUX kraft-0.80-qt-5.11.patch 1810 BLAKE2B d7225869ca03b2723d40d0d0218e93bb57abe0f1e43c3198d513801083ad64021c32de980c92b155f43100165f4c2867f4d685f5fbab76dd1fbdc8e50eb037de SHA512 db33309419879abaa644a0a7aa50648c3e8d93543c9bbf8f2db34326a82d47113cc1896702ad1cc5d71cc87b8a88613917f10c0e1dfdce65f86200914509e4dd +DIST kraft-0.80.tar.gz 673818 BLAKE2B 80d9608c458b793e7f1fe2f568243c72512ff9bd7a4e3b4ba8232d7b47b890e60b6e93cd0fcf2204027abc942198f6f2f5d10248e77b2f4729d3345631883dbc SHA512 a8a1496db434f899e293c765a9733bfb2d5ec6d461da3a3d805f52befa4e71526a3b5f21a7edf214d4946b8d409133dac77050452db97fb46256377960649fe9 +EBUILD kraft-0.80.ebuild 1175 BLAKE2B 2a6b010f412f77fcf76c195685d5173238e9988650232603b9e3635c99d562aede6991e3457e32f725e94105868a03b27fb161b48a5bcaa46c6475775ca1e3b9 SHA512 9b528b6989dfe26470fc6f810f23492a923d5e6edac3f79a286dbe8e0d66d975d4bc601b1350dd446b972b192f207e57cd1a7aa79784a1de11f3177a8e596f67 +MISC metadata.xml 418 BLAKE2B b99b3d436a90af1cd1a791e8cd1aeaed2c654a659a45f5e88b5c5b0cd02d57bc15df8e225cd93e9041732dfbf45792721d29df8c2187d409ecf3a4202855266e SHA512 eb8a053a7375546c713741d2bcacdb4604c725322c6680d76eade40ea4166cf20d8ecef4c4f0a7ef4304961bf2740b8277f5372137e04d32a52bc254daf65232 diff --git a/app-office/kraft/files/kraft-0.80-qt-5.11.patch b/app-office/kraft/files/kraft-0.80-qt-5.11.patch new file mode 100644 index 000000000000..33a6a769bd5f --- /dev/null +++ b/app-office/kraft/files/kraft-0.80-qt-5.11.patch @@ -0,0 +1,63 @@ +From 29cd92c31705fbe63dfb324b5beb3758967dc900 Mon Sep 17 00:00:00 2001 +From: Andreas Sturmlechner <andreas.sturmlechner@gmail.com> +Date: Tue, 3 Apr 2018 17:05:06 +0200 +Subject: [PATCH] Fix build with Qt 5.11 + +--- + src/flostempldialog.cpp | 1 + + src/importitemdialog.cpp | 1 + + src/materialkatalogview.cpp | 1 + + src/setupassistant.cpp | 1 + + 4 files changed, 4 insertions(+) + +diff --git a/src/flostempldialog.cpp b/src/flostempldialog.cpp +index 420b10e..e705ec7 100644 +--- a/src/flostempldialog.cpp ++++ b/src/flostempldialog.cpp +@@ -16,6 +16,7 @@ + ***************************************************************************/ + + // include files for Qt ++#include <QButtonGroup> + #include <QRadioButton> + #include <QLabel> + #include <QString> +diff --git a/src/importitemdialog.cpp b/src/importitemdialog.cpp +index a02c7d4..70d524e 100644 +--- a/src/importitemdialog.cpp ++++ b/src/importitemdialog.cpp +@@ -19,6 +19,7 @@ + + // include files for Qt + #include <QLabel> ++#include <QButtonGroup> + #include <QComboBox> + #include <QCheckBox> + #include <QToolTip> +diff --git a/src/materialkatalogview.cpp b/src/materialkatalogview.cpp +index 76c0b2b..fd0f277 100644 +--- a/src/materialkatalogview.cpp ++++ b/src/materialkatalogview.cpp +@@ -15,6 +15,7 @@ + * * + ***************************************************************************/ + ++#include <QHeaderView> + #include <QLayout> + #include <QLabel> + #include <QSplitter> +diff --git a/src/setupassistant.cpp b/src/setupassistant.cpp +index 1ea1d5b..4dd0ef3 100644 +--- a/src/setupassistant.cpp ++++ b/src/setupassistant.cpp +@@ -17,6 +17,7 @@ + #include <QtGui> + + #include <QDebug> ++#include <QTabWidget> + + #include <kcontacts/address.h> + #include <kcontacts/vcardconverter.h> +-- +2.17.0 + diff --git a/app-office/kraft/kraft-0.80.ebuild b/app-office/kraft/kraft-0.80.ebuild new file mode 100644 index 000000000000..ea0cd15a44f1 --- /dev/null +++ b/app-office/kraft/kraft-0.80.ebuild @@ -0,0 +1,51 @@ +# Copyright 1999-2018 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 + +EAPI=6 + +KDE_HANDBOOK="forceoptional" +inherit kde5 + +DESCRIPTION="Software to manage quotes and invoices in small enterprises" +HOMEPAGE="http://www.volle-kraft-voraus.de/" +SRC_URI="https://github.com/dragotin/${PN}/archive/v${PV}.tar.gz -> ${P}.tar.gz" + +KEYWORDS="~amd64 ~x86" +IUSE="pim" + +DEPEND=" + $(add_frameworks_dep kconfig) + $(add_frameworks_dep kconfigwidgets) + $(add_frameworks_dep kcoreaddons) + $(add_frameworks_dep ki18n) + $(add_frameworks_dep kwidgetsaddons) + $(add_frameworks_dep kxmlgui) + $(add_kdeapps_dep kcontacts) + $(add_qt_dep qtgui) + $(add_qt_dep qtsql) + $(add_qt_dep qtwidgets) + $(add_qt_dep qtxml) + dev-cpp/ctemplate + pim? ( + $(add_kdeapps_dep akonadi) + $(add_kdeapps_dep akonadi-contacts) + ) +" +RDEPEND="${DEPEND} + !app-office/kraft:4 +" + +DOCS=( AUTHORS Changes.txt README.md Releasenotes.txt TODO ) + +PATCHES=( "${FILESDIR}/${P}-qt-5.11.patch" ) + +S="${WORKDIR}/${PN}-${PV/_/}" + +src_configure() { + local mycmakeargs=( + $(cmake-utils_use_find_package pim KF5Akonadi) + $(cmake-utils_use_find_package pim KF5AkonadiContact) + ) + + kde5_src_configure +} diff --git a/app-office/kraft/metadata.xml b/app-office/kraft/metadata.xml new file mode 100644 index 000000000000..5884c2d79636 --- /dev/null +++ b/app-office/kraft/metadata.xml @@ -0,0 +1,14 @@ +<?xml version="1.0" encoding="UTF-8"?> +<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d"> +<pkgmetadata> + <maintainer type="project"> + <email>kde@gentoo.org</email> + <name>Gentoo KDE Project</name> + </maintainer> + <upstream> + <remote-id type="github">dragotin/kraft</remote-id> + </upstream> + <use> + <flag name="pim">Enable support for KDE PIM resources integration</flag> + </use> +</pkgmetadata> |